Select FLEX Ex I/O Modules
Step 2 – Select:
I/O modules based on field devices
FLEX Ex follows a producer/consumer model for remote I/O. Input modules
produce data for the system. Controllers, output modules, and intelligent
modules produce and consume data. The producer/consumer model multicasts
data. This means that multiple nodes can consume the same data at the same time
from a single device.
FLEX Ex I/O modules offer 2 through 16 I/O each. You can connect together a
maximum of eight FLEX Ex I/O modules with a FLEX Ex I/O adapter, for a
maximum of 128 I/O per assembly.
Mix and match digital and analog I/O to meet your application needs.
Digital I/O Modules
Digital I/O modules have digital I/O circuits that interface to on/off sensors
(pushbuttons and limit switches) and actuators (motor starters, pilot lights, and
annunciators).
These outputs are controlled by the PLC controller while the inputs control the
state of corresponding bits in the PLC.
Features
• Modules detect, indicate, and report the following faults:
– open input or output field devices or wiring
– shorted output field devices
– shorted input or output wiring
– Selectable input filter times from less than 1 to 33 ms.
• LED for each channel indicating status of:
–corresponding input device
–output signal
